Definition

Exporters must maintain active registrations with Directorate General of Foreign Trade (DGFT), Marine Products Export Development Authority (MPEDA), Export Inspection Council (EIC), and Food Safety and Standards Authority of India (FSSAI). Each has separate renewal cycles and documentation requirements. Missing any single registration results in shipment holds and potential license revocation.
